What’s next for Gaza as ceasefire takes hold


Wednesday, October 15, 2025-A fragile ceasefire in Gaza has momentarily quieted months of devastation, but uncertainty still hangs heavy in the air. Both Israel and Hamas claim small victories, while humanitarian groups race to deliver aid to a region battered by loss.


With power grids crippled and hospitals overwhelmed, Gaza’s recovery is now a question of political will as much as survival.

The global reaction is mixed relief tempered by doubt. In Western capitals, leaders praise the ceasefire yet avoid the deeper debate about accountability and occupation.

Arab nations cautiously welcome the calm, demanding that this truce not be another pause before the next bombardment. On social media, survivors’ voices are haunting reminders of what peace must actually mean.

The next chapter for Gaza may determine whether this conflict ends or merely resets. Reconstruction could open dialogue or deepen divisions depending on who controls the future.
